South Kenton is a station without a formal ticket office, but it doesn't leave passengers high and dry. With accessible ticket machines available that cater to both standard and London Underground services, commuters have a hassle-free way to collect their pre-purchased tickets or buy new ones. Unfortunately, if you're a tech-savvy traveler hoping to utilize a smartcard, you'll find South Kenton lacks the facilities to support this technology.
While the station doesn't boast an array of amenities, it aims to create a safe environment with CCTV surveillance. For those needing assistance, there’s staffing during the majority of the day, along with a dedicated help point. Accessibility does pose some challenges, as step-free access and ramps are not present, which can impact those with mobility needs.
Getting to and from South Kenton without a car is a breeze. Travelers can take advantage of the integrated transport links, like nearby bus services and additional walking access to the London Underground. For those journeys subject to rail replacement services, convenient bus stops on Belsize Road ensure continuity of travel north to Watford Junction or south to Euston. Though the Etchingham station does not boast the size of a city-centre terminal, it doesn't skimp on the essentials. The ticket office is open Monday to Saturday, and there are ticket machines conveniently located near the entrance to platform 1. For those who prefer the flexibility of planning ahead, smartcards can be issued and collected at this station despite the absence of smartcard validators.
Accessibility at Etchingham station is considered with thoughtful detail. While there is some step-free access, it's important to note the restrictions, like the lack of a step-free interchange between platforms. Assistance is available during staffing hours, and a dedicated help point ensures that travelers can smoothly navigate the station.
For those continuing their journey beyond Etchingham, onward travel options are well-covered. Rail replacement services are organized from the car park next to platform 2, easily discoverable using the What3Words address: tactical.district.lawfully. Furthermore, local bus connections can be crucial, and detailed journey planning information is available here.
